What are the key Pennsylvania state laws I need to know before purchasing a firearm in Christiana?
In Pennsylvania, all handgun purchases require a background check through the Pennsylvania Instant Check System (PICS) and a mandatory waiting period, though long guns do not have a waiting period. Private sales of handguns must go through a licensed dealer for a background check. Additionally, there is no state firearm registration, but a License to Carry Firearms (LTCF) is required for concealed carry.
How does the FFL transfer process work at gun shops in Christiana, PA?
FFL transfers at Christiana-area shops like Tanners or Morr's involve receiving a firearm shipped from an online retailer or private seller. You'll need to provide identification, complete a federal Form 4473, and pass a PICS background check. The shop will charge a transfer fee, typically ranging from $25 to $50, and handle all required paperwork to ensure compliance with state and federal laws.

Are there any local ordinances in Christiana, PA, that affect gun ownership or usage?
Christiana, as a borough in Lancaster County, generally follows Pennsylvania state preemption laws, which prohibit local municipalities from enacting firearms regulations stricter than state law. However, you should always check for any specific borough rules regarding discharge of firearms or transportation.
